Hello Iqbal, it would also be helpful to us to know what resources are
available to your students.  For example, do they have access to computers
with screen readers?  If so, which operating systems and screen reader? Or
do they rely entirely on paper braille?  What kinds of resources are
available to you and to others who must communicate with the blind students.

Our best advice will be heavily dependent on resource limitations in
Bangladesh.  Personally I feel that blind students who do not have access to
a computer are severely handicapped.  Any blind student having access to a
computer and screen reader can do a great deal more both in reading and in
writing materials intended to be read by sighted people.  If the student
must depend on paper braille, then an intermediate transcriber will always
be essential.  But if those intermediaries are available, blind students can
still learn and do math and science.  It has been done before in poor
countries.
